diff options
Diffstat (limited to 'gcc')
-rw-r--r-- | gcc/ChangeLog | 12 | ||||
-rw-r--r-- | gcc/config/i386/go32-rtems.h | 5 | ||||
-rw-r--r-- | gcc/config/i386/rtems.h | 6 | ||||
-rw-r--r-- | gcc/config/i960/rtems.h | 5 | ||||
-rw-r--r-- | gcc/config/m68k/rtems.h | 5 | ||||
-rw-r--r-- | gcc/config/mips/rtems64.h | 5 | ||||
-rw-r--r-- | gcc/config/pa/rtems.h | 5 | ||||
-rw-r--r-- | gcc/config/rs6000/rtems.h | 7 | ||||
-rw-r--r-- | gcc/config/sh/rtems.h | 5 | ||||
-rw-r--r-- | gcc/config/sparc/rtems.h | 7 |
10 files changed, 61 insertions, 1 deletions
diff --git a/gcc/ChangeLog b/gcc/ChangeLog index 1168dc09e7b..9485347a1fc 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,15 @@ +Wed Mar 25 01:06:49 1998 Joel Sherrill (joel@OARcorp.com) + + * config/i386/go32-rtems.h: Defined TARGET_MEM_FUNCTIONS. + * config/i386/rtems.h: Likewise. + * config/i960/rtems.h: Likewise. + * config/m68k/rtems.h: Likewise. + * config/mips/rtems64.h: Likewise. + * config/pa/rtems.h: Likewise. + * config/rs6000/rtems.h: Likewise. + * config/sh/rtems.h: Likewise. + * config/sparc/rtems.h: Likewise. + Wed Mar 25 00:57:26 1998 Richard Kenner <kenner@vlsi1.ultra.nyu.edu> * pa.c (emit_move_sequence): If in reload, call find_replacement. diff --git a/gcc/config/i386/go32-rtems.h b/gcc/config/i386/go32-rtems.h index 99bada61aa6..9ae1998db51 100644 --- a/gcc/config/i386/go32-rtems.h +++ b/gcc/config/i386/go32-rtems.h @@ -31,5 +31,10 @@ Boston, MA 02111-1307, USA. */ #define CPP_PREDEFINES "-Dunix -Di386 -DGO32 -DMSDOS -Drtems -D__rtems__ \ -Asystem(unix) -Asystem(msdos) -Acpu(i386) -Amachine(i386) -Asystem(rtems)" +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if + /* end of i386/go32-rtems.h */ diff --git a/gcc/config/i386/rtems.h b/gcc/config/i386/rtems.h index b31ceb9f799..60e6dc7c419 100644 --- a/gcc/config/i386/rtems.h +++ b/gcc/config/i386/rtems.h @@ -26,3 +26,9 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Di386 -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(i386) -Amachine(i386)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if + diff --git a/gcc/config/i960/rtems.h b/gcc/config/i960/rtems.h index 714706859d9..909fc73d532 100644 --- a/gcc/config/i960/rtems.h +++ b/gcc/config/i960/rtems.h @@ -26,3 +26,8 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Di960 -Di80960 -DI960 -DI80960 -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(i960) -Amachine(i960)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if diff --git a/gcc/config/m68k/rtems.h b/gcc/config/m68k/rtems.h index 77c02f8e9c8..20e623e60fb 100644 --- a/gcc/config/m68k/rtems.h +++ b/gcc/config/m68k/rtems.h @@ -26,3 +26,8 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Dmc68000 -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(mc68000) -Acpu(m68k) -Amachine(m68k)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if diff --git a/gcc/config/mips/rtems64.h b/gcc/config/mips/rtems64.h index 6433ed56498..a321d0df576 100644 --- a/gcc/config/mips/rtems64.h +++ b/gcc/config/mips/rtems64.h @@ -26,3 +26,8 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Dmips -DMIPSEB -DR4000 -D_mips -D_MIPSEB -D_R4000 \ -Drtems -D__rtems__ -Asystem(rtems)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if diff --git a/gcc/config/pa/rtems.h b/gcc/config/pa/rtems.h index eebfd4f5cc1..a0d5b7a9470 100644 --- a/gcc/config/pa/rtems.h +++ b/gcc/config/pa/rtems.h @@ -24,3 +24,8 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Dhppa -DPWB -Acpu(hppa) -Amachine(hppa) \ -Drtems -D__rtems__ -Asystem(rtems)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if diff --git a/gcc/config/rs6000/rtems.h b/gcc/config/rs6000/rtems.h index c00c5ad7704..83073b072e7 100644 --- a/gcc/config/rs6000/rtems.h +++ b/gcc/config/rs6000/rtems.h @@ -27,4 +27,9 @@ Boston, MA 02111-1307, USA. */ #define CPP_PREDEFINES "-DPPC -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(powerpc) -Amachine(powerpc)" -/* end of powerpc-rtems.h */ +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if + +/* end of rs6000/rtems.h */ diff --git a/gcc/config/sh/rtems.h b/gcc/config/sh/rtems.h index f35f734d13b..1b2242bf0a4 100644 --- a/gcc/config/sh/rtems.h +++ b/gcc/config/sh/rtems.h @@ -26,3 +26,8 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-D__sh__ -D__ELF__ -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(sh) -Amachine(sh)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if diff --git a/gcc/config/sparc/rtems.h b/gcc/config/sparc/rtems.h index 55b7779818a..1ab0a4216fd 100644 --- a/gcc/config/sparc/rtems.h +++ b/gcc/config/sparc/rtems.h @@ -26,3 +26,10 @@ Boston, MA 02111-1307, USA. */ #undef CPP_PREDEFINES #define CPP_PREDEFINES "-Dsparc -D__GCC_NEW_VARARGS__ -Drtems -D__rtems__ \ -Asystem(rtems) -Acpu(sparc) -Amachine(sparc)" + +/* Generate calls to memcpy, memcmp and memset. */ +#ifndef TARGET_MEM_FUNCTIONS +#define TARGET_MEM_FUNCTIONS +#endif + +/* end of sparc/rtems.h */ |